Presenting the opportunity to acquire the fee simple interest (land & building ownership) in an absolute NNN leased, investment property located in the Forestdale Community in Birmingham, AL (Birmingham AL MSA). The tenant, Church's Chicken, has 4 years remaining with 2 (5-year) options to extend, demonstrating their commitment to the site. The lease features rental increases every year throughout the initial term and each option period, steadily growing NOI. The lease is absolute NNN with zero landlord responsibilities making it an ideal, management free investment opportunity for a passive investor. The asset is located in a busy retail corridor with a traffic count of over 22, 000 VPD

Birmingham remains the largest city in Alabama and one of the top 50 metropolitan areas in the United States. As of 2025, the Birmingham-Hoover MSA has a population of 1, 184, 290, with Jefferson and Shelby counties accounting for over 75% of the total. A major financial center in the Southeast, Birmingham is home to the headquarters of Regions Financial and Protective Life Corporation, with PNC Bank also maintaining a significant presence. The financial activities sector employs approximately 44, 000 people in the metro area. The city is a regional healthcare powerhouse. The University of Alabama at Birmingham (UAB) remains the largest employer in the region, with 28, 000 employees and 1, 207 hospital beds. UAB has acquired St. Vincent’s Health System, a move expected to further consolidate Birmingham’s healthcare leadership. The education and health services sector employs over 80, 600 people as of May 2025. UAB also plays a critical role in education, with an enrollment of approximately 21, 000 students. Its annual economic impact in Alabama was reported at $12.1 billion in 2022, and its influence continues to grow. In terms of economic development, Birmingham saw 1, 800 new multifamily housing units delivered in the past year, with 1, 422 units currently under construction, reflecting strong investor confidence. The business confidence index for the metro rose sharply to 60.6 in Q1 2025, the highest since 2021, signaling optimism in future economic conditions . The unemployment rate in the Birmingham MSA stood at 2.6% as of May 2025, indicating a healthy labor market. With its affordable tax climate, low cost of living, and charming Southern appeal, Birmingham continues to attract both residents and businesses. Expanding capital investment and job creation reflect growing confidence in the metro’s economic future. The addition of Protective Stadium and the Coca Cola Amphitheater makes the Birmingham area attractive for both sporting events and entertainment.
